Nipaniya Population - Shahdol, Madhya Pradesh
Nipaniya is a medium size village located in Sohagpur Tehsil of Shahdol district, Madhya Pradesh with total 255 families residing. The Nipaniya village has population of 1170 of which 584 are males while 586 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Nipaniya village population of children with age 0-6 is 208 which makes up 17.78 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Nipaniya village is 1003 which is higher than Madhya Pradesh state average of 931. Child Sex Ratio for the Nipaniya as per census is 1019, higher than Madhya Pradesh average of 918.
Nipaniya village has lower literacy rate compared to Madhya Pradesh. In 2011, literacy rate of Nipaniya village was 61.43 % compared to 69.32 % of Madhya Pradesh. In Nipaniya Male literacy stands at 69.44 % while female literacy rate was 53.43 %.
